GoGPT GoSearch New DOC New XLS New PPT

OffiDocs favicon

Habit Building - Gantt Chart - One Page

Download and customize a free Habit Building Gantt Chart One Page Excel template. Perfect for business, legal, and personal use. Editable and ready to boost your productivity.

Habit Building Gantt Chart

Habit Name Start Date End Date Duration (Days) Status
Daily Meditation (10 min) 2024-04-01 2024-06-30 91
Read 20 Pages Daily 2024-04-01 2024-12-31 305
Exercise (30 min) 2024-04-01 2024-12-31 305
Write in Journal (15 min) 2024-04-01 2025-03-31 365
Drink 8 Glasses of Water 2024-04-01 2025-12-31 679
Weekly Planning (Sundays) 2024-04-01 2025-12-31 679
Limit Screen Time (2 hrs) 2024-04-01 2025-12-31 679
Learn a New Skill (30 min/day) 2024-04-15 2025-11-30 594
Practice Gratitude Daily 2024-04-01 2025-12-31 679
Weekly Digital Detox (Saturdays) 2024-04-06 2025-12-31 679

* Progress bars represent completion rate as of today (April 5, 2024).


Habit Building Gantt Chart Template (One Page) – Excel Workbook

This comprehensive and visually intuitive Excel template is specifically designed to support long-term habit building through a dynamic, interactive, and streamlined one-page dashboard. By combining the visual clarity of a Gantt chart with structured planning features for daily/weekly habit tracking, this single-sheet template empowers users to monitor progress, visualize streaks, set milestones, and maintain motivation—all within a compact yet powerful interface.

Sheet Names

  • HabitTracker (Primary sheet – the one-page Gantt chart dashboard)
  • Settings & Help (Optional, for reference and instructions; can be hidden or locked)

Table Structure: One-Page Gantt Chart Layout

The entire template is built on a single worksheet named HabitTracker. This one-page design ensures that users can see their complete habit plan in a unified view without tab-switching. The structure is divided into three core sections:

  1. Header & Settings Row: Contains date range, default habit frequency, and display options.
  2. Habit List Section: A vertical list of habits with their start dates, target duration, and progress bars.
  3. Gantt Chart Area: A horizontal timeline spanning weeks or days, visually representing the execution status of each habit over time.

Columns and Data Types

The following columns are defined with their respective data types and purposes:

<<
Column Data Type Description
A – Habit NameText (String)Name of the habit (e.g., "Drink 2L Water", "Read 10 Pages")
B – Start DateDate (Calendar format)When the habit begins; defaults to today's date.
C – Target Duration (Days)Numeric (Integer)Number of days for which the habit should be tracked.
D – FrequencyText (Dropdown: Daily, Weekly, 3x/Week, etc.)Select how often the habit should be performed.
E – Completion Status (%)Numeric (0–100%)Auto-calculated progress toward completion based on actual done entries.
F – Streak Counter (Days)Numeric (Integer)
G – Last Completed DateDate
Gantt Chart Timeline Columns (Dynamic - auto-generated based on Start Date & Duration)
Columns from H onwards represent daily or weekly dates in sequence (e.g., H = 01/04, I = 01/05, J = 01/06… up to the end of the target duration). Each cell contains a conditional indicator.

Formulas Required

To maintain automation and accuracy, several formulas are embedded across the sheet:

  • Progress Calculation (E2):
    =IF(COUNTIFS($A$2:$A$100, A2, $G$2:$G$100, "<>" & "")=0, 0%, (COUNTIFS($A$2:$A$100, A2, $G$2:$G$100, "<>" & "") / C2) * 100%)
  • Streak Counter (F2):
    =IF(G2="", 0, IF(G2=DATE(YEAR(TODAY()), MONTH(TODAY()), DAY(TODAY())), IF(OR(F1="", G1=""), 1, F1+1), IF(ABS((TODAY() - G2)) <= 7, IF(DATE(YEAR(G2), MONTH(G2), DAY(G2)+7) < TODAY(), (TODAY() - DATE(YEAR(G2), MONTH(G2), DAY(G2))) + 1, (DATE(YEAR(TODAY()), MONTH(TODAY()), DAY(TODAY())) - G2)), 0 ) )
  • Dynamic Timeline Headings:
    Use a formula in each timeline header (H1, I1, etc.) to auto-generate dates: =IF(H$1="", "", $B2 + COLUMN()-8)
  • Gantt Cell Logic (e.g., H2):
    =IF(AND($B2 + COLUMN() - 8 <= TODAY(), $B2 + C2 > COLUMN() - 8), IF(OR(H$1="Today", $G$1=H$1), "✓", "●"), IF($B2 + COLUMN() - 8 < $B2, "", "") )

Conditional Formatting Rules

  • Progress Bar (E column): Use data bars (green gradient) to show % completion visually.
  • Gantt Cells:
    • "✓": Green fill, bold text – indicates today’s completed habit.
    • "●": Yellow fill – marks past days where the habit was due but not completed.
    • Empty cells: Light gray or white – upcoming days.
  • Streak Counter: If F2 > 7, apply a red-orange gradient to highlight long streaks.

User Instructions

  1. Select the cell under "Start Date" (B2) and enter your habit's start date.
  2. Enter the number of days for the habit duration in column C (e.g., 30 for a 30-day challenge).
  3. Select frequency from dropdown in D2 (use Data Validation).
  4. Each day, go to the corresponding Gantt cell (e.g., H2) and enter "✓" if completed.
  5. The progress percentage and streak counter update automatically.
  6. Add new habits by copying row 2 down. The timeline expands dynamically as needed.

Example Rows

Habit Name: Exercise 30 min
Start Date: 04/01/2025
Target Duration (Days): 30
Frequency: Daily
Status (%): 85%
Streak: 17 days
Gantt Cell Status (as of 04/18/2025):
Habit Name: Meditate 10 min
Start Date: 04/03/2025
Target Duration (Days): 21
Frequency: Daily
Status (%): 67%
Streak: 14 days
Gantt Cell Status (as of 04/18/2025):

Recommended Charts & Dashboards

Although this is a one-page template, you can embed these visualizations in the side margins or use adjacent cells:

  • Doughnut Chart (Top Right): Shows % of habits completed vs. incomplete.
  • Line Chart (Below Gantt): Tracks streak progression over time for top 3 habits.
  • Bar Graph: Compares average completion rates across different habit types.

This Excel template is an ideal tool for anyone committed to consistent behavior change. By merging the power of a Gantt chart with the personal growth journey of habit building, it offers clarity, accountability, and motivation—delivered in a sleek, efficient one-page design that fits seamlessly into your daily routine.

⬇️ Download as Excel✏️ Edit online as Excel

Create your own Excel template with our GoGPT AI prompt:

GoGPT
×
Advertisement
❤️Shop, book, or buy here — no cost, helps keep services free.